Can late 2014 Mac mini be upgraded?

Mac mini (Late 2014) has memory that is integrated into the main logic board and can’t be upgraded.

Will Big Sur run on Mac Mini 2014?

Here’s an overview of the Macs that will run Big Sur: MacBook models from early 2015 or later. MacBook Pro models from 2013 or later. Mac mini models from 2014 or later.

Should I upgrade Mac Mini to Catalina?

The bottom line: Most people with a compatible Mac should now update to macOS Catalina unless you have an essential incompatible software title. If that’s the case, you may want to use a virtual machine to keep an old operating system in place to use the outdated or discontinued software.

Is the Mac mini worth it?

The Mac mini has always been Apple’s most flexible desktop computer. Sure, most people go for the traditional experience and plug in a display, mouse, and keyboard — but you can also have it serve as a home theater PC, or put it to work with professional photo or audio editing, or turn a group of minis into a server farm.
